Does NKP end up with 40% of the 1 million oz pa forecast platinum production or 50%?
I was under the impression that if the BFS demonstrates an acceptable ‘internal hurdle rate’ then Xstrata would earn a 37% interest and would then acquire a further 13% from Genorah Resources to take its overall interest to 50%. Nkwe at this point would be diluted to 47% but would acquire a 3% interest from Genorah Resources thus reaching 50% as well.
The final ownership would then stand at 50:50 between Xstrata and Nkwe. At that stage Nkwe’s share of concentrate would be free to be sold to any third party. Is the 50:50 partnership correct or does Nkwe end up as a junior partner?
Seems that if everything goes to plan that Genorah Resources will control > 50% of NKP share capital which I understand would be greater than BEE legislative requirements.
Is that maybe seen as a problem for the company by the market?
